The maximum power dissipation of the LF347DG4 is dependent on the package type and thermal resistance. For the DIP package, the maximum power dissipation is approximately 670mW. For the SOIC package, it is approximately 450mW.

While the LF347DG4 is an op-amp, it can be used as a comparator in a pinch. However, it's not recommended as it's not optimized for comparator applications. The LF347DG4 has a relatively slow slew rate and may not provide the desired performance in high-speed comparator applications.

The LF347DG4 has a relatively high noise floor and may not be the best choice for high-fidelity audio applications. However, it can be used in lower-fidelity audio applications or where noise is not a critical concern.
